In general terms, the surface temperature of a planet decreases as its distance from the sun increases. However, Venus is approx 90% further from the sun than Mercury. But, instead of the temperature being lower, it is approx 40% higher.
Uranus is the coldest planet. Neptune is the furthest from the Sun, but it has a much hotter core temperature than Uranus; Neptune's core is at around 7000 °C. Uranus's core's temperature is at around 4737 °C.
